Banco Bilbao Vizcaya Argentaria  (BSP:BILB34) Capital Adequacy Tier - Leverage Ratio % Explanation

Capital Adequacy Tier - Leverage Ratio % measures a bank's capital relative to its total assets. In this situation, total assets means a bank's total exposures, which include its consolidated assets, derivative exposure and certain off-balance sheet exposures.

The leverage ratio is used by regulators to ensure the capital adequacy of banks and to limit the degree to which banks can leverage its capital base. The higher the leverage ratio is, the more likely a bank can withstand negative shocks to its balance sheet.

Banco Bilbao Vizcaya Argentaria (BSP:BILB34) Business Description

Address
Calle Azul, 4, Madrid, ESP, 28050
Despite its Spanish origins, BBVA generates only around a quarter of its profits in Spain. We expect that on a normalised basis, BBVA's market-leading Mexican bank should contribute half of its earnings, while its Turkish operation should account for another 15%. The balance of BBVA's earnings comes from smaller operations in South America. BBVA is overwhelmingly a retail and commercial bank, with corporate and investment banking forming a minor part of the overall business. BBVA also offers insurance and investment products through its banking networks.
